The Toyota 1SZ-FE is a compact, highly efficient 1.0-liter inline-four engine introduced in 1999 for compact cars like the Toyota Vitz, Yaris, and Platz. Developed in collaboration with Daihatsu, this powerhouse features a Dual Overhead Cam (DOHC) design and Toyota’s proprietary VVT-i (Variable Valve Timing with intelligence) technology. For mechanics, DIY restorers, and car enthusiasts, mastering the "top end" of this engine—the cylinder head, valvetrain, camshafts, and timing chain—is critical for maintaining its signature reliability and fuel economy.
